The Community House is hosting its inaugural Health and Wellness four-part series, which will highlight various topics that are prevalent to the needs of area. Sponsored and in partnership with St. Joseph Mercy Oakland, the series is free to attend.

Medical experts will provide insight as well as provide the opportunity to foster an open dialogue while answering health-related questions at The Community House.

On Feb. 19, Heart and Stroke Health will be presented by Dr. Kirit Patel, who is the chairman for the Department of Medicine and medical director of cardiology, and Dr. Charles Schwartz, who is the director of cardiothoracic surgery. Spine Health in the 21st Century will be presented by Dr. Yoav Ritter, who is a neurological surgeon, on Feb. 24.

Past sessions included Advancements in Prostrate Screening presented by Dr. Sanjeev Kaul on Jan. 20 and Opioid Stewardship presented by Dr. Diane Morris on Jan. 27.

The sessions include light beverages and refreshments and additional health resources. Doors will open at 6 p.m. and the presentation will follow at 6:30.
